Nenad Rikalo is still working as minister of agriculture on the Kosovo Government's official website, and the Ministry of Agriculture's, even though the prime minister has released him from office on Saturday at the request of the PSD.
KTV learns from close sources with developments that each of the ruling parties is targeting that dictatorship, even starting to bring the prime minister's proposals.
But, in the prime minister's office, they say it has not yet been decided who the new minister will succeed Serbian Nenad Ricalo is.
Neither Ricalo nor other Serbian ministers have attended any of the government's meetings since March 26th last year, in protest of Marko Djuric's arrest at the time.
In Government, they say there is still no decision for other Serbian ministers.
Meanwhile, the party that conditioned the prime minister's dismissal of Ricalos, The PSD calls for an expert to be appointed in the Ministry of Agriculture.
In the party of Shpend Ahmeti, they have said they are exploiting this weak government to work for the interests of citizens, but deny there is more Africa among them.
On Saturday, Kosovo's Assembly has held sessions from dawn until midnight to realise the 5 PSD requirements that had conditioned it to vote on Kosovo's budget.
